It’s time they got their due and thus Mouth Factory which is a master project taken up by Cheng Guo is a marvellous effort. They have come out with a series of tools that will not make use of your hands but just your mouth and specifically your teeth. Your teeth will hold onto these tools after they have been fitted onto your jaw.
In an interview Guo said, “People use their mouth to suck on a bleeding wound, bite ingrown nails, and sometimes we even try to blow little objects (like a pill) out of the small crevices under the bed and other places as we awkwardly lie prone on the floor.” “The more they occur in everyday life, the more we take them for granted.”
Explaining about his Mouth Factory he said that it’s a five-piece Craftsman tool set that has been taken from ‘A Clockwork Orange’ which is a series of intricate devices.
